The Choctaws hold 140 miles on the Missipi

every 11. miles E. & W. there, give 1. Milln. as.

<when they pass Wilkinson’s line,>

from mouth of Yazoo to line of 31.° is 100. miles

15. mi. E. & W. on 100. mi. length give 1. milln. as.


from 31.° to 34°–30 little prairie 240. miles

7. mi. E. & W. thro’ that length, give 1. milln. as.


all the Choctaw lands on the waters of the Mispi. are abt 10. millions as. an annuity of 6000. D. would be a principal of 100,000. suppose their debts 50,000. makes 150,000

equal to 1½ cents per acre
